On 11.11.2010 17:48, Tom Lane wrote: > "Yeb Havinga"<yebhavinga@gmail.com> writes: >> postgres=# create table a as select ''::oidvector; >> SELECT 1 >> postgres=# copy a to '/tmp/test' with binary; >> COPY 1 >> postgres=# copy a from '/tmp/test' with binary; >> ERROR: invalid oidvector data > > The problem seems to be that array_recv passes back a zero-dimensional > array, *not* a 1-D array, when it observes that the input has no > elements. A zero-D array is not part of the subset of possible arrays > that we allow for oidvector. Yeah, I just reached that conclusion too.. > I'm less than convinced that this is worth fixing. oidvector is not > intended for general-purpose use anyway. What's the use-case where this > would come up? I don't see any use case either, but I guess it would be nice to fix for the sake of completeness. -- Heikki Linnakangas EnterpriseDB http://www.enterprisedb.com
